Response to What happens after the court orders repossession?

If the Court has already granted an order for repossession, then it should say on the order when you have to move out of your home. I believe its usually 28 days, although it does depend on your circumstances.

If you've been given a date for a court hearing for the possession, then I urge you to go. If you've got a family then the Judge will usually grant as much time as s/he can. If there is any chance that you can pay off your arrears, the court hearing is your chance to do it.
